CF104 Posted March 26, 2024 Share Posted March 26, 2024 1 hour ago, IAGeezer said: The F-4 didn't have a HUD. It looks similar to a HUD but doesn't function as one. It was called the Optical Sight Unit and did not contain flight data like a HUD does. It was used for weapons deployment. Basically a glorified gunsight.
